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

results-resultat and departmental-plans-ministeriels #2479

Open
wants to merge 3 commits into
base: master
Choose a base branch
from
Open
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
18 changes: 18 additions & 0 deletions components/gc-contributors/_base.scss
Original file line number Diff line number Diff line change
@@ -0,0 +1,18 @@
/* Contributors */

.gc-contributors {
margin-top: 38px;

h2, ul {
font-size: $small-size;
margin-top: 0;
}

ul {
padding-inline-start: 20px;

li {
font-weight: $bold-weight;
}
}
}
31 changes: 31 additions & 0 deletions components/gc-contributors/_screen-md-min.scss
Original file line number Diff line number Diff line change
@@ -0,0 +1,31 @@
/*
WET-BOEW
@title: Medium view and over (screen only)
@desc: Variable $screen-md-min >= 992px
*/

.gc-contributors {
display: flex;

h2 {
line-height: 1.8em;
}

ul {
padding-inline-start: 5px;

li {
display: inline-block;
margin-right: .5em;

&::after {
content: "\2022";
margin-left: .7em;
}

&:last-child::after {
content: none;
}
}
}
}
21 changes: 21 additions & 0 deletions components/gc-contributors/gc-contributors-en.html
Original file line number Diff line number Diff line change
@@ -0,0 +1,21 @@
---
{
"title": Contributors,
"description": Working example for the Contributors component,
"language": en,
"altLangPage": gc-contributors-fr.html,
"dateModified": 2024-05-28,
"breadcrumbs": [
{ "title": "Contributors - Documentation", "link": "components/gc-contributors/gc-contributors-doc-en.html" }
]
}
---
<span class="wb-prettify all-pre hide"></span>

<p>Lorem ipsum dolor sit amet consectetur, adipisicing elit. Eum incidunt recusandae quae omnis laudantium mollitia minima! Vel laudantium quae dolorem et error, quas exercitationem ut. Facilis dolores nemo ullam sequi quod ea praesentium rem, consequuntur qui, sed reiciendis commodi excepturi aperiam obcaecati odit minima maiores? Nostrum illo adipisci iste consectetur.</p>

<p>Lorem ipsum dolor sit amet consectetur adipisicing elit. Distinctio tenetur, atque odit, recusandae iure illo deleniti culpa, pariatur iste suscipit doloremque quisquam reprehenderit sequi iusto! Molestiae itaque ipsa aliquid rerum atque, consequuntur vel nihil optio cumque in dolorem. Sint voluptates ipsa dicta sequi reiciendis corporis eaque ipsam omnis, quasi quo velit illo unde perspiciatis! Eaque minima, facilis corporis aperiam ea aut suscipit nulla, magni dolorem distinctio aspernatur in cupiditate? Rem nihil dolores rerum, sequi, veritatis, nobis minima adipisci qui veniam vel repudiandae. Et consectetur hic veritatis, tenetur officia architecto quos quas magnam tempora voluptatum quaerat doloremque ipsa porro harum suscipit.</p>

{% highlight html %}{%- include_relative samples/gc-contributors.html -%}{% endhighlight %}

{%- include_relative samples/gc-contributors.html -%}
21 changes: 21 additions & 0 deletions components/gc-contributors/gc-contributors-fr.html
Original file line number Diff line number Diff line change
@@ -0,0 +1,21 @@
---
{
"title": Collaborateurs,
"description": Exemple pratique de la composante Collaborateurs,
"language": fr,
"altLangPage": gc-contributors-en.html,
"dateModified": 2024-05-28,
"breadcrumbs": [
{ "title": "Collaborateurs - Documentation", "link": "components/gc-contributors/gc-contributors-doc-fr.html" }
]
}
---
<span class="wb-prettify all-pre hide"></span>

<p>Lorem ipsum dolor sit amet consectetur, adipisicing elit. Eum incidunt recusandae quae omnis laudantium mollitia minima! Vel laudantium quae dolorem et error, quas exercitationem ut. Facilis dolores nemo ullam sequi quod ea praesentium rem, consequuntur qui, sed reiciendis commodi excepturi aperiam obcaecati odit minima maiores? Nostrum illo adipisci iste consectetur.</p>

<p>Lorem ipsum dolor sit amet consectetur adipisicing elit. Distinctio tenetur, atque odit, recusandae iure illo deleniti culpa, pariatur iste suscipit doloremque quisquam reprehenderit sequi iusto! Molestiae itaque ipsa aliquid rerum atque, consequuntur vel nihil optio cumque in dolorem. Sint voluptates ipsa dicta sequi reiciendis corporis eaque ipsam omnis, quasi quo velit illo unde perspiciatis! Eaque minima, facilis corporis aperiam ea aut suscipit nulla, magni dolorem distinctio aspernatur in cupiditate? Rem nihil dolores rerum, sequi, veritatis, nobis minima adipisci qui veniam vel repudiandae. Et consectetur hic veritatis, tenetur officia architecto quos quas magnam tempora voluptatum quaerat doloremque ipsa porro harum suscipit.</p>

{% highlight html %}{%- include_relative samples/gc-contributors.html -%}{% endhighlight %}

{%- include_relative samples/gc-contributors.html -%}
Original file line number Diff line number Diff line change
@@ -0,0 +1,9 @@
---
title: Departmental Plan Combined
description: Departmental plans page template.
language: en
altLangPage: dp-combined.md
dateModified: 2025-02-24
layout: documentation
index_json: index.json-ld
---
1,001 changes: 1,001 additions & 0 deletions templates/departmental-plans-ministeriels/dp-combined.md

Large diffs are not rendered by default.

131 changes: 131 additions & 0 deletions templates/departmental-plans-ministeriels/index.json-ld
Original file line number Diff line number Diff line change
@@ -0,0 +1,131 @@
{
"@context": {
"@version": 1.1,
"dct": "http://purl.org/dc/terms/",
"title": { "@id": "dct:title", "@container": "@language" },
"description": { "@id": "dct:description", "@container": "@language" },
"modified": "dct:modified"
},
"title": {
"en": "Departmental plans",
"fr": "Plans departmental"
},
"description": {
"en": "Departmental plans page template.",
"fr": "Plans departmental pour tous les services."
},
"modified": "2025-02-24",
"componentName": "departmental plans ministeriels",
"status": "stable",
"version": "1.0",
"pages": {
"examples": [
{
"title": "Departmental plans combined",
"language": "en",
"path": "dp-combined.md"
},
{
"title": "Plans ministeriels conjoint",
"language": "fr",
"path": "pm-plan-ministeriel-conjoint.md"
}
],
"docs": [
{
"title": "Departmental plans combined",
"language": "en",
"path": "dp-combined.md"
},
{
"title": "Plans ministeriels conjoint",
"language": "fr",
"path": "pm-plan-ministeriel-conjoint.md"
}
]
},
"a11yGuidance": "No accessibility guidance.",
"variations": [
{
"name": {
"en": "Departmental plans",
"fr": "Plans departmental"
},
"status": "stable",
"description": {
"en": "Departmental plans template.",
"fr": "Plans departmental pour tous les services."
},
"iteration": "_:iteration_departmental_plans_1",
"example": [
{
"en": { "href": "dp-combined.md", "text": "Departmental plans" },
"fr": { "href": "pm-plan-ministeriel-conjoint.md", "text": "Plans departmental" }
}
],
"implementation": [
"_:implement_departmental_plans"
],
"history": [
{
"en": "January 2025 - Initial implementation of the page template.",
"fr": "Janvier 2025 - Implémentation initiale du gabarit de page."
}
]
}
],
"implementation": [
{
"@id": "_:Departmental plans",
"iteration": "_:iteration_Departmental plans_1",
"name": {
"en": "Standard",
"fr": "Standard"
},
"introduction": {
"en": "This implementation is meant for publishers adding the template manually into an AEM page.",
"fr": "Cette implémentation est destinée aux éditeurs qui ajoutent le gabarit manuellement à une page d'AEM."

},
"instructions": {
"en": [
"Refer to the working example and guidance for more information on how to implement this page template."
],
"fr": [
"Référez-vous à l'exemple pratique et aux directives pour plus d'informations sur l'implémentation ce modèle de page."
]
},
"ajaxSourceCode": {
"en": "dp-combined.md main > *:not(.pagedetails)",
"fr": "pm-plan-ministeriel-conjoint.md main > *:not(.pagedetails)"
}
}
],
"iteration": [
{
"@id": "_:iteration_departmental plans_1",
"name": "Departmental plans - Iteration 1",
"date": "2025-01",
"detectableBy": ""
}
],
"changesets": [
{
"@id": "_:cs_departmental_plans",
"name": "Departmental plans",
"status": "stable",
"baseOnIteration": "_:iteration_departmental_plans_1",
"detectableBy": "By the sequence of elements.",
"semantic": "h1 + h2*3 + h1 + h2*n",
"accessibility": "",
"context": "",
"layout": [
"Top serches navigation band",
"Most requested services navigation band",
"Supporting through life's transitions navigation band",
"Most requested - version 1 (optional)",
"Series of <details> elements for all goc themes and topics"
]
}
]
}
Original file line number Diff line number Diff line change
@@ -0,0 +1,9 @@
---
title: Plan departmental conjoint
description: Plans departmental pour tous les services.
language: fr
altLangPage: pm-plan-ministeriel-conjoint.md
dateModified: 2025-02-24
layout: documentation
index_json: index.json-ld
---
Loading